Output 81b381f1327efa6ede4e502ea200fd969995c2addf28c81b2815474d12d436af:0

value
18751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3bfca2fb63bbb4d99bcd51e500d6f02ad26553 OP_EQUAL
address
3LDcxSo8Tow7fLS1Gwb7QYkogEnT2oDRUr
transaction
81b381f1327efa6ede4e502ea200fd969995c2addf28c81b2815474d12d436af
spent
true